NAVFACSYSCOM NORTHWEST Shipyard Infrastructure and Optimization Program ( SIOP) P454 Multi- Mission Dry Dock ( M2D2) - Title: Shipyard Infrastructure Optimization Program Multi- Mission Dry Dock, Multiple Award Construction Contract Type: Sources Sought Notice Location: Puget Sound Naval Ship

Shipyard Infrastructure Optimization Program Multi- Mission Dry Dock Multiple Award Construction Contract ( MACC) for waterfront and marine mega construction projects, including design- build ( DB) and design- bid- build ( DBB) projects. Specific task order packages may include marine pier construction, building construction, upland utility demolition, dredging, shoring, cofferdam construction, dry dock construction, dewatering, pumpwell installations, infrastructure support buildings, electrical substations, utility tunnels, caisson fabrication and installation, testing, and commissioning.

06/22/2026 - USA | WA | KITSAP COUNTY | SILVERDALE | 98383 Small City

Silverdale Water District - WA

Ridgetop & Waaga Way Water Main Extension, Silverdale Water District, Silverdale, WA - Bids are being asked for provision of all necessary labor, equipment and materials required to construct two water main extensions listed as Schedule A - Potable Water Main: approximately 575 linear feet of 12- inch diameter water main and other appurtenances within a Public road; and Schedule B - Recycled Water Main: approximately 580 linear feet of 12- inch diameter water main and other appurtenances within a Public roa
